Overall Satisfaction with Quip
Quip is being used across about 30% of the organization primarily as a document collaboration tool. It's quite similar to google docs. It's leveraged for work that needs to be more real-time collaborative vs. email. The @ mention comment feature is used heavily.
Pros
- Single sign-on via Okta.
- A simple to understand product.
- Collaboration features such as @ mention commenting.
- Fairly priced.
Cons
- Could use more differentiation vs. larger incumbent players in this space, such as Google Work Suite
- More features to make the tool feel more 'on brand' for your particular company.
- An excel and powerpoint add-in to make it more competitive with other incumbents.

While Quip is a fine tool, I personally would recommend an organization leverage Google Work Suite for Docs, Slides, and Sheets over Quip. I found Quip's feature set to be limited in relation to Google, all things considered. However, Quip can be valuable if your company has an aversion to Google (e.g. direct competitor).
